Primary Responsibilities

HDR is looking for a Project Manager to join our Federal Business Group. This position will be located in the Mid-Atlantic Region with the primary offices being Virginia Beach, VA or Arlington, VA office, but other offices within the Region may be considered. Duties include project management of multi-discipline planning and design teams to support large, medium, and small-scale federal projects, including both vertical and horizontal facilities.

The Federal Senior Project Manager will deliver various projects across the company portfolio and will have responsibilities including but not limited to the following:

  • Lead and manage teams to execute the planning, design, and construction support activities throughout the life of assigned projects and successfully deliver multiple ongoing projects.
  • Be responsible for achieving the scope, schedule, and budget for each assigned project to meet both client and company expectations.
  • Be customer focused including establishing new client relationships and maintaining existing ones.
  • Ability to be a team builder and lead multi-discipline project teams throughout the complete life cycle of projects including marketing, proposal development, negotiations, and contract execution.
  • Additional responsibilities will include working with accounting managers, project controllers, and area manager for project reviews and implementation of QA/QC procedures.
  • Candidates must be willing to travel throughout the U.S. and potentially abroad.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in engineering, architecture, or related field from an accredited institution.
  • Professional registration in the United States, PE or AIA.
  • 10+ years of combined design and project management experience for Federal clients including but not limited to USACE, NAVFAC, OBO, and WHS.
  • Demonstrated knowledge of Federal project life cycle including Initiation, Planning, Design, Procurement, Construction, Post Construction, and Project Closeout.
  • Ability to pass a background check to obtain and maintain a Security Clearance; due to client contract requirements only candidates with US citizenship will be considered for the position as permitted pursuant to section 274B(a)(2)(C) of the Immigration and Nationality Act.
  • Experience working in an Integrated Delivery scenario such as Design Build (D/B) or Early Contractor Involvement.
  • Advanced Degree in related field from an accredited institution.
  • Project Management Professional (PMP) certification.
  • LEED BD+C certification.
  • Certified Energy Manager (CEM) certification.
  • Local candidates preferred.
  • This position is subject to a governmental background check.

Qualifications

Required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Engineering
  • 7 years related experience
  • A minimum 2 years project management experience
  • Professional Engineer (PE) license
  • MS Office and MS Project experience is required (Access experience would be plus)
  • Demonstrated leadership skills
